Indore: fake Army man’s car-nama puts him in trouble

Indore: In another case of embezzlement by a fake army officer has come to light on Tuesday when a man lodged a complaint with police in Jansunwai for being duped of Rs 1.60 lakh.

Victim Nitesh Yadav, who is a wrestler by profession, had spotted an advertisement of a car for sale on OLX website after which he contacted the accused Vikas Patel, resident of Jabalpur for the second hand car.

“The accused introduced himself as an army officer and told me that he had to rush to Kashmir following the Pulwama attack and hence was selling his car for Rs 2.10 lakh. However, the deal was finalised at Rs 1.60 lakh,” Nitesh told the police.
He said that the accused took about Rs 1.52 lakh from him through Paytm but later denied to give him the car.

“Smelling rat, I lodged a complaint with the police,” the victim said. Police have been investigating the case on the basis of number provided by the victim.
